Output c68de69291104402f1c0e8a6fe28c92cd54c9705a65878bcb0e4c9ef65f35fd7:1

value
84408132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ea35372a457cf4dad7eb1a4b41dc935cd5f6c4 OP_EQUALVERIFY OP_CHECKSIG
address
18U8Jb2D45xAYYrEH1v5tczhrPo9PCEpMP
transaction
c68de69291104402f1c0e8a6fe28c92cd54c9705a65878bcb0e4c9ef65f35fd7
confirmations
522549
spent
true